From 87a19c9bae4dc0d88c6bb2c9d164db6198e8f6ee Mon Sep 17 00:00:00 2001 From: kevinyzheng Date: Wed, 21 Dec 2022 18:19:52 +0800 Subject: [PATCH] =?UTF-8?q?fix(editor):=20=E4=BB=A3=E7=A0=81=E5=9D=97?= =?UTF-8?q?=E5=88=97=E8=A1=A8=E6=97=A0=E6=B3=95=E6=BB=9A=E5=8A=A8?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../sidebar/code-block/CodeBlockList.vue | 112 +++++++++--------- packages/editor/src/theme/code-block.scss | 2 + 2 files changed, 59 insertions(+), 55 deletions(-) diff --git a/packages/editor/src/layouts/sidebar/code-block/CodeBlockList.vue b/packages/editor/src/layouts/sidebar/code-block/CodeBlockList.vue index dbbdcb4f..8408601a 100644 --- a/packages/editor/src/layouts/sidebar/code-block/CodeBlockList.vue +++ b/packages/editor/src/layouts/sidebar/code-block/CodeBlockList.vue @@ -17,63 +17,65 @@ - - + + @@ -89,7 +91,7 @@ import { computed, inject, reactive, ref, watch } from 'vue'; import { Close, Edit, Link, View } from '@element-plus/icons-vue'; import { cloneDeep, forIn, isEmpty } from 'lodash-es'; -import { TMagicButton, TMagicInput, tMagicMessage, TMagicTooltip, TMagicTree } from '@tmagic/design'; +import { TMagicButton, TMagicInput, tMagicMessage, TMagicScrollbar, TMagicTooltip, TMagicTree } from '@tmagic/design'; import { CodeBlockContent, Id } from '@tmagic/schema'; import StageCore from '@tmagic/stage'; diff --git a/packages/editor/src/theme/code-block.scss b/packages/editor/src/theme/code-block.scss index 6d78e783..2d9d66d7 100644 --- a/packages/editor/src/theme/code-block.scss +++ b/packages/editor/src/theme/code-block.scss @@ -1,5 +1,7 @@ .m-editor-code-block-list { + height: 100%; margin-top: 5px; + .el-tree-node__content { height: auto; }